Grapefruit Imports
Imports into Libya
In 2022, after three years of growth, there was significant decline in supplies from abroad of grapefruits, when their volume decreased by -38.4% to X tons. Overall, imports continue to indicate a significant contraction.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 332%.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ure at X tons in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, imports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, grapefruit imports dropped remarkably to $X in 2022. In general, imports faced a significant dec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 322%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um at $X in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, imports failed to regain momentum.
Imports by Country
In 2022, Egypt (X tons) was the main supplier of grapefruit to Libya, with a 93% share of total imports. It was followed by the Netherlands (X kg), with a 1.5% share of total imports.
From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of volume from Egypt stood at -30.9%.
In value terms, Egypt ($X) constituted the largest supplier of grapefruits to Libya, comprising 84%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by the Netherlands ($X), with a 2.3% share of total imports.
From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value from Egypt amounted to -26.7%.
